Positioning of Appliance for Final Installation – no
obstructions.
If appliance weight is over 25 kg always use 2 persons
to move where practical.
Fit bracket securely onto wall before lifting appliance
into position.
Obtain firm grip on front and sides of appliance, lift
upwards, ensure stable balance achieved and lift up-
wards to position in place on bracket.
Ensure safe lifting techniques are used – keep back
straight – bend using legs - when lifting load from
floor level.
Do not twist – reposition feet instead.
Keep boiler as close as possible to body throughout
lift to minimise strain on back.
Ensure co-ordinated movements to ensure equal
spread of weight of load.
Always use assistance if required.
Recommend wear suitable cut resistant gloves with
good grip to protect against sharp edges and ensure
good grip when handling appliance.

Positioning of Appliance for Final Installation – within
compartment etc. restricting installation.
If appliance weight is over 25 kg always use 2 persons
to move where practical.
Fit bracket securely onto wall before lifting appliance
into position.
Obtain firm grip on front and sides of appliance, lift
upwards, onto worktop if practicable.
Ensure stable balance achieved and lift upwards to
drop into place onto bracket.
If 2 persons positioning onto bracket obtain firm grip
at front and sides/base of boiler.
Ensure coordinated movements during 2 person lifts
to ensure equal spread of weight of load.
If 1 person positioning onto bracket recommend obtain
firm grip supporting base of boiler.
Ensure safe lifting techniques are used – keep back
straight – bend using legs - when lifting load from
floor level.
Do not twist – reposition feet instead.
Keep boiler as close as possible to body throughout
lift to minimise strain on back.
Always use assistance if required.
Recommend wear suitable cut resistant gloves with
good grip to protect against sharp edges and ensure
good grip when handling appliance.
Positioning of Appliance for Final Installation – in
roof space restricting installation.
If appliance weight is over 25 kg always use 2 persons
to move where practical.
Obtain firm grip on front and sides of appliance, lift
upwards, ensure stable balance achieved and lift up-
wards to drop into place onto bracket.
If 2 persons positioning onto bracket obtain firm grip
at front and sides/base of boiler.
Ensure co-ordinated movements during 2 person lifts
to ensure equal spread of weight of load.
If 1 person positioning onto bracket recommend obtain
firm grip supporting base of boiler.
Ensure safe lifting techniques are used - keep back
straight – bend using legs - when lifting load from
floor level.
Do not twist – reposition feet instead.
Keep boiler as close as possible to body throughout
lift to minimise strain on back.
Always use assistance if required.
Recommend wear suitable cut resistant gloves with
good grip to protect against sharp edges and ensure
good grip when handling appliance.
It is recommended a risk assessment of the roof space
area be carried out before moving the appliance into
the area to take into account access, stability of floor-
ing, lighting and other factors, and appropriate meas-
ures taken.
